Evaluation of Improving the Health Care System of Bogatan, Doti (IHSP)

,

Background: UMN has been implementing the Improving Health Care System of Bogatan, Doti Project (IHSP) in the Bogatan Phudsil Rural Municipality of Doti district. This initiative is conducted in partnership with the Centre for Equal Access for Development (CEAD Nepal) and is funded by the Gossner Mission. The IHSP is implemented in one to seven wards of Bogatan Phudsil RM. The IHSP is a three-year project that was initiated in January 2023 and will end in December 2025.

The project is designed to strengthen the local government’s healthcare system and enhance the skills of health workers, which could help them deliver improved services to women of reproductive age and young people. This is achieved by engaging community groups, mothers’ groups, families, and key stakeholders such as government health providers and female community health volunteers. The range of services addressed through the project includes maternal and child health, family planning, adolescent sexual and reproductive health, and mental health. Additionally, the initiative focuses on improving overall health governance.

The goal of the IHSP is to improve access to health services among the community people of Bogatan Phudsil RM.

Purpose of evaluation

The endline evaluation assesses the project’s effectiveness, impact, sustainability, lessons learned, and achievement of intended outcomes, providing insights and recommendations to guide UMN’s future similar projects.
